Brown Industries is considering replacing an old machine that is currently being used. The old machine is fully depreciated, but it can be used for another 7 years, at which time it would have no salvage value. Brown can sell the old machine for $60,000 on the date that the new machine is purchased. Brown has an effective tax rate of 30%, so the gain on the sale of the old machine will be fully taxable.

If the purchase occurs, the new machine will be acquired for a cash payment of $1,000,000. Because of the increased efficiency of the new machine, estimated annual cash savings of $300,000 would be generated during its useful life of 5 years. The new machine is expected to have a salvage value of $30,000.

Brown has a minimum required rate of return of 10% and uses MACRS depreciation. The machine falls into the five year asset category with the half-year convention which has the following depreciation rates:

Year Rate

1 20%

2 32%

3 19.20%

4 11.52%

5 11.52%

6 5.76%

Create and submit a printout of an Excel spreadsheet (along with the spreadsheet in formula view using the CTRL ~ function) that will answer the following questions:

1) What is the net present value of replacing the old machine with the new machine? (Use the =NPV function and then subtract the initial cash outflow to obtain the net present value).

2) What is the internal rate of return to replace the old machine? (Use the =IRR function).

3) What is the payback period for the new machine?

4) Should Brown purchase the new machine? Why or why not? You can type your answer in your Excel spreadsheet.
